Understanding the Culprits Behind Hair Loss
Hair loss isn’t just about genetics. While it’s true that family history plays a significant role, other factors such as stress, diet, hormonal changes, and medical conditions can also contribute to thinning locks. Where to Go for Professional Testing
So, you’ve noticed some hair loss and want to know why. The first step is visiting a dermatologist. These skin specialists are experts in hair issues and can perform various tests to determine the underlying cause. Blood tests, scalp biopsies, and even genetic testing can all provide valuable insights. Think of it as getting a full-body check-up, but focused on your follicles! 💊🔬
Taking Action: What Comes Next?
Once you’ve identified the cause of your hair loss, it’s time to take action. Depending on the diagnosis, treatments can range from over-the-counter medications like minoxidil to prescription drugs like finasteride. Lifestyle changes, such as reducing stress, improving diet, and avoiding harsh hair treatments, can also make a big difference.
